The book explores the significant rightward shift of the Supreme Court and federal appellate courts, driven by a concerted effort from conservative lawmakers and presidents to reinterpret the Constitution. It highlights how conservative justices have restricted constitutional protections, impacting millions of Americans. Through the lens of constitutional law, Erwin Chemerinsky illustrates the profound consequences of these judicial changes, emphasizing their relevance to the daily lives of citizens and the erosion of long-standing legal principles.
